Fill Out the Sam's Club Job Application to Begin Your New Retail Career

Founded in 1983, Sam’s Club is a large chain of warehouse-style retail outlets. Operating over 600 stores, Sam’s Club constantly needs to hire entry-level workers to staff retail locations. If you’re at least 18 years old, you’re qualified to submit the Sam’s Club application form. Read on to learn about Sam’s Club jobs open in your area.

Consider the following retail jobs available at Sam’s Club stores:

  • Cashier – Cashiers at Sam’s Club work in the front of the store and assist customers with their purchases. These workers check memberships, operate cash registers, handle returns, and provide other kinds of customer service. The job is entry-level, requiring no previous work experience. Cashiers typically make starting pay just above minimum wage.
  • Sales Associate – Retail sales associates perform entry-level customer service duties as well as stocking shelves, organizing merchandise, and creating product displays. The average sales associate makes starting wages between $8 and $12 per hour, depending on location and experience. Entry-level workers who excel as cashiers and sales associates may earn promotions into store management.
  • Management – Managerial workers supervise retail operations, keep crew members on task, and provide customer service during certain situations. Administrative functions, such as hiring new employees, training new hires, and making the work schedule, are also part of a manager’s job. Applicants must at least have a high school diploma and some retail experience to apply for managerial positions. Sam’s Club managers can expect to make salaries between $25,000 and $60,000 per year, depending on job title, location, and experience.

Qualified Sam’s Club employees have access to considerable benefits packages. If eligible, employees receive healthcare coverage, 401(k) retirement plans, store discounts, time off, and many other employment perks. Benefits will vary by job title and location, but all store associates will be able to take advantage of job training, flexible schedulingFeature Articles, and free store memberships.
